Transaction 516008d52bfb73dd8f8ef3024d4e03273bc688d67c19b0834c223d4e7df94efb

block
fd26caabe4129771e5a8c298f03dc1d414583afd70184639bf1432d0354c83b6

1 Input

2 Outputs